2 solar eclipses in 2090: partial on 31 March, total on 23 September. Paths, times and how much of the Sun is covered.
- Partial solar eclipse, 31 March 2090 no path of totality
- Total solar eclipse, 23 September 2090 up to 3m 36s of totality
Lunar eclipses the same year
- Total lunar eclipse, 15 March 2090 totality 63m 00s
- Total lunar eclipse, 8 September 2090 totality 31m 54s
